Intellectual Property

Unilateral and drafted in favor of the Client (i.e., the Company). The Client will own all intellectual property created by the Service Provider.  This short-form clause covers (1) assignment of work product to the Client, (2) further assurances, and (3) infringement.

For additional intellectual property clauses, see the Intellectual Property (Employment Agreements) clause and the Intellectual Property (Confidentiality Agreements) clause.
